Sage Lenier

Sage Lenier

Sage Lenier is an activist working to build an education system that enables the next gen to become climate solutionists. She got her start teaching her own program at UC Berkeley, which broke records for largest-ever student-led class. Her work has been featured in The New York Times, The World Economic Forum, and Teen Vogue, and has brought her to speak at public forums around the world. TIME Magazine named her a 2023 Next Generation Leader for her work with Sustainable & Just Future.
